1,5-Dichloro-2-methyl-4-nitrobenzene synthesis

3synthesis methods
-

Yield:7149-77-1 91%

Reaction Conditions:

with HNO3 in 1,2-dichloro-ethane at 30 - 35; for 2 h;Temperature;Reagent/catalyst;

Steps:

4-5; 2 Example 5:Preparation method of dichlorotoluene nitrate intermediate (preparation of 2,4-dichloro-5-nitrotoluene),The difference from Example 4 is that it is prepared through the following steps:

Step 1. Dissolve 32.2g (0.2mol) of 2,4-dichlorotoluene in 100g of dichloroethane in a three-necked flask,Slowly add 13.9g (0.22mol) of 98% nitric acid at 30°C and keep the temperature of the reaction system not exceeding 35°C.After the dropwise addition was completed, the reflux reaction was performed for 2.0 hours, monitored by TLC, and after the reaction was completed, a dichloroethane solution of 2,4-dichloro-5-nitrotoluene was obtained.Step 2: Add a saturated sodium bicarbonate aqueous solution to the above solution for cleaning and neutralization, and dichloroethane is distilled out.After cooling and crystallizing and drying, 37.5 g of yellow solid: 2,4-dichloro-5-nitrotoluene was obtained, and the yield was 91%.
